Enercon outsources blade supply for Turkish projects

GERMANY: Enercon has signed a long-term supply agreement with US blade manufacturer TPI for production in Turkey.

TPI Composite's plants in Izmir will supply rotor blades for Enercon's new EP3 turbine platform

The deal breaks new ground for the German turbine maker, which has hitherto produced blades in exclusive factories in Germany, Portugal and Brazil.

"The decisive reason behind the agreement was local content requirements for projects in Turkey," said Enercon. But it added that the deal brings logistic and cost advantages that "are significant against the background of increasing competitive and cost pressure".

The blades for Enercon’s new EP3 platform will be produced on two manufacturing lines at one of TPI’s two facilities in Izmir. Production will start in Q4 2018.

Enercon needed a swift supply source since the first EP3 turbines will be installed in Turkey late this year. It described the deal with TPI as the "optimal" alternative to building its own production facility.
